The giant panda, with its iconic black and white markings, is an animal that captivates the world. For many, the immediate question is simple: what family is a panda in? The answer places them within the order Carnivora, specifically in the family Ursidae, making them true bears. However, this classification comes with a fascinating caveat, as their biology and behavior reveal a remarkable evolutionary adaptation to a diet primarily composed of bamboo.
Taxonomic Classification: Bears by Definition
To understand the panda's family, one must look at its scientific classification. Genetically and physically, pandas belong to the family Ursidae, the same family that includes brown bears, polar bears, and black bears. Key skeletal features, such as the structure of their carnassial teeth and the number of chromosomes, confirm their status as members of the bear family. They are not a type of raccoon or red panda, which belong to their own distinct families, despite sharing some superficial similarities with the giant panda.
The Evolutionary Anomaly of the Bamboo Diet
What makes the giant panda so unique within the family Ursidae is its diet. While other bears are omnivorous hunters or opportunistic feeders, the giant panda has evolved to survive almost entirely on bamboo. This dietary shift represents a significant evolutionary divergence; they possess a specialized thumb, actually an elongated wrist bone, which acts like a pseudo-opposable thumb to grasp stalks. Their powerful jaws and flat molars are perfectly adapted for crushing and grinding this tough, fibrous plant, a stark contrast to the teeth of their more carnivorous relatives.
Behavioral Traits Linking Pandas to Bears
Despite their specialized herbivorous lifestyle, pandas exhibit core behavioral traits inherent to the family Ursidae. They are largely solitary animals, coming together only for mating, a characteristic common to many bear species. Furthermore, their method of communication, which involves marking territory with scent glands and vocalizing through bleats and honks, aligns with the behavioral repertoire of other bears. Even their impressive physical strength, used to climb trees and defend territory, is a hallmark of the bear family.
Addressing Common Misconceptions
Because of the giant panda's highly specialized bamboo diet, a common misconception is that they are not true carnivores or bears. This is inaccurate from a biological standpoint. While they may not hunt large prey, their digestive system is still that of a carnivore, inefficient at extracting nutrients from plant matter compared to true herbivores. This inefficiency is a key reason why they spend up to 14 hours a day eating, consuming vast quantities of bamboo to meet their energy needs. They are classified as carnivores by digestive design but have adapted to a herbivorous niche.
Conservation and the Symbol of the Bear Family
Understanding that the giant panda belongs to the family Ursidae is crucial for conservation efforts. As a bear species, they face similar threats, including habitat fragmentation and human-wildlife conflict. Their status as an umbrella species means that protecting the bamboo forests they inhabit also safeguards countless other organisms within that ecosystem. The successful recovery of panda populations in the wild is a testament to conservation science, highlighting the importance of preserving the genetic diversity and natural habitats of this remarkable member of the bear family.
